Planning a destination wedding requires thoughtful coordination and creativity.
The first step is selecting the ideal location that aligns with the couple’s vision. Popular choices include tropical beaches in Goa or Bali, royal palaces in Rajasthan, vineyards in Italy, or mountain retreats in Switzerland.
Once the destination is finalized, arrangements for travel, accommodation, décor, and local experiences come into play. Many couples hire professional wedding planners who specialize in destination events to ensure every detail is executed flawlessly.
One of the biggest advantages of a destination wedding is the opportunity to combine the wedding and honeymoon into one seamless celebration. Guests can enjoy a mini-vacation while attending the wedding festivities, making it a joyful experience for everyone involved.
